What are the word parts of cognitive?

The word "cognitive" comes from the Latin word "cognoscere", which means "to know" or "to learn".

Here's a breakdown of its word parts:

* Cogn-: This is the root of the word and it means "to know".

* -itive: This is a suffix that means "relating to" or "characterized by".

Therefore, "cognitive" literally means "relating to knowing" or "characterized by knowing".
